Red de conocimiento informático - Aprendizaje de código fuente - Varias piezas en programación CNC

Varias piezas en programación CNC

1. Portador del programa de procesamiento: cuando las máquinas herramienta CNC están funcionando, los trabajadores no necesitan operar directamente las máquinas herramienta. Para controlar las máquinas herramienta CNC es necesario programar programas de mecanizado. El programa de procesamiento de piezas incluye la trayectoria de movimiento relativa de la herramienta y la pieza de trabajo en la máquina herramienta, los parámetros del proceso (velocidad de avance, velocidad del husillo, etc.) y el movimiento auxiliar.

Los programas de procesamiento de piezas se almacenan en soportes de programas con determinados formatos y códigos, como cintas de papel perforadas, cintas de casete, disquetes, etc. , y la información del programa se ingresa a la unidad CNC a través del dispositivo de entrada de la máquina herramienta CNC.

2. Dispositivo CNC: El dispositivo CNC es el núcleo de las máquinas herramienta CNC. Todos los dispositivos CNC modernos adoptan la forma de CNC (control numérico por computadora), que generalmente utiliza múltiples microprocesadores para implementar funciones CNC en forma de software de programación, por lo que también se le llama software NC.

El sistema CNC es un sistema de control de posición que interpola la trayectoria de movimiento ideal en función de los datos de entrada y luego la envía al componente de ejecución para procesar las piezas requeridas. Por tanto, los equipos CNC se componen principalmente de tres partes básicas: entrada, procesamiento y salida. Todas estas tareas están organizadas racionalmente mediante programas del sistema informático para que todo el sistema pueda funcionar en armonía.

Datos ampliados:

Para piezas con formas geométricas complejas, es necesario escribir el programa fuente de la pieza en el lenguaje CNC especificado y luego generar el programa de procesamiento después del procesamiento. lo que se llama programación automática.

Con el desarrollo de la tecnología CNC, los sistemas CNC avanzados no solo brindan preparación general y funciones auxiliares para la programación del usuario, sino que también brindan a la programación un medio para ampliar las funciones del CNC. La programación de parámetros del sistema CNC FANUC6M es de aplicación flexible y de forma gratuita. Tiene expresiones, operaciones lógicas y flujos de programas similares a los lenguajes informáticos de alto nivel, lo que hace que el programa de procesamiento sea simple y fácil de entender, y realiza funciones que son difíciles de lograr con la programación ordinaria.

Enciclopedia Baidu-Programación CNC